Position Overview

As a Mechanical Designer, the ideal candidate will draft sketches, piping and instrument diagrams, or model 3D equipment items for power plant systems including steam cycle systems, boiler feed and condensate, water treatment, fuel handling, hydraulic, heat transfer systems, conveying systems, and air and gas systems. Additonally, this role will train and advise interns and new grads.

Responsibilities

Draft sketches, piping and instrument diagrams, or model 3D equipment items for power plant systems including steam cycle systems, boiler feed and condensate, water treatment, fuel handling, hydraulic, heat transfer systems, conveying systems, and air and gas systems.

Check design deliverables in accordance with industry codes and standards, contract requirements, and company standards.

Adhere to schedules and work assignments to ensure successful project completion.

Coordinate with other drafters, designers and other team members assigned to a project or task, and support work progress and results.

Train and advise interns or new graduates

Qualifications

A minimum of 3 years' related design experience

Bachelor's degree in Drafting and Design or related discipline

Proficient in basic computer programs including MS Word and Excel, web browsing and e-mail programs

Knowledge of drafting software including MicroStation, Autodesk, SmartPlant
